Download Instructions:

You can download the latest version of WishList Member from within your WishList Member Dashboard.  You will see a link to the latest version.

Here is a sample screenshot:

Best practices include…

1)  Deactivating WLM first (you’re settings won’t be lost).

2)  Unzip the WLM zip file.

3)  Upload the “wishlist-member” folder to your WP plugins folder.

This will overwrite the old version (don’t worry, your settings will still be there!).  If you’re uploading using an FTP program, make sure your “transfer type” settings are “Binary” and NOT “ASCII”.

4)  Then activate WLM in your plugins.

    OK, how do you get your files to show in the Manage Content -> Files section? I ftp’d files into the wp-content/uploads folder, but they aren’t visible. Using wp to upload has a limit of 2 mb. Some of my files are over 100 mb.

    • WPWL Team August 13, 2010 at 8:54 am #

      We use the defined WP upload folder to look for our files to protect. Default is wp-content/uploads, so that is correct. In order for the file to show in our file protection area the files must be uploaded using the Media section in WP-ADMIN and those files can only be a maximum of 64MB.

    I have a couple of concerns, hope you can clear them out for me:

    * The best payment system that I can use is MoneyBrooker does it support it? if not, how can I integrate it into WishList?

    * My site will focus on Arabic users meaning the text and layout should be from Right to Left and I need to translate it into Arabic, so is that doable?

    Thanks :)

    • WPWL Team August 24, 2010 at 1:21 pm #

      WishList Member can be integrated using a FULL or SIMPLE method. We currently integrate FULLY with PayPal, ClickBank and QuickPayPro (Cydec) – what FULL integration means is that if a user cancels their payment in the online shopping cart it will communicate with WishList Member and block that user’s membership. With that being said, WishList Member does offer SIMPLE Integration with all online payment options. What this means is that if a user cancels payment or doesn’t pay for some reason you will have to manually cancel them within WishList Member.

      We have included the language pack in the newest release of WL Member. It will require you to install the Q-Translate plugin for WordPress. It is a free PlugIn that you can get more information about here:

      http://wordpress.org/extend/plugins/qtranslate/

      You would then have to see if you are able to translate and have a format to your liking. The language can be changed, but you may have issues with getting the layout to be right to left.
